Event Description
It was reported that the cardiac resynchronization therapy defibrillator (crt-d) exhibited premature battery depletion.It was suspected the premature depletion was due to a high threshold on the left ventricular (lv) lead.The lv lead was explanted and replaced with the crt-d.No patient complications have been reported as a result of this event.
 
Manufacturer Narrative
Product event summary: the lead was not returned for analysis, however, performance data collected from the device was received and analyzed.Analysis of the device memory was performed and no anomalies were found.If information is provided in the future, a supplemental report will be issued.
